Ethereum’s Devconnect 2025 in Buenos Aires could become the Web3 event of the year, maybe even the decade. It will take place November 17-22 in a hybrid, city-scale format: a central venue at La Rural featuring 10 stages and 40+ independently programmed events, plus the inaugural Ethereum World’s Fair -- eight districts where Web3 newcomers can set up a wallet, on-ramp into crypto, and even buy food with it. Have you ever wondered how zero-knowledge proofs are proven, what infrastructure is needed, and who supports such innovations that boost our decentralized future? Daria is excited to have Teemu Päivinen, the founder and CEO of Gevulot and ZK Cloud, as the guest for this interview. Gevulot is the first universal proving layer for ZK. It's designed to decrease the cost of proving by aggregating workloads across all use cases, allowing it to optimally utilize the underlying hardware.
